Trojans Dominate Against Alabama State
4/3/2018 8:31:00 PM | Tennis (W)
RESULTS
TROY, Alabama- The last women's tennis match at the Lunsford Tennis Complex for the season was a successful one as the Trojans downed in-state opponent Alabama State 6-1 on Tuesday afternoon.
Troy got off to a great start winning two of the three doubles matches to take the first point of the match. Freshmen Pei Ju Hsieh and Maria Casas Blas picked up the first win of the day, a 6-3 victory on court three to even the match at 1-1 as Alabama State took the court-one match. Senior duo Jiayuan Xue and Efriliya Herlina battled and eventually came out on top, 7-5, to clinch the doubles point for the Trojans.
The momentum remained in Trojan territory as Troy won five of the six singles matches. Hsieh started singles competition with a 6-2, 6-2 win on court six, followed by a win from one-seeded Sanae Ohta at 6-4, 6-0 to give Troy a 3-0 lead.
The match was clinched by Xue who delivered a 6-2, 6-2 win on court three. With the game already in the bag for the Trojans, freshman Matea Mihaljevic and senior Nancy Karaky added to the point total with 6-4, 6-4 and 5-7, 6-0, 10-4 respective wins, giving the Trojans six total points on the day.
Troy will close out regular season play as it travels to Atlanta to face Coastal Carolina and Appalachian State in neutral territory on Saturday and Sunday, April 7 and 8.
